Travel Score in 27613, Raleigh, North Carolina

The Travel Score for the Prostate Cancer Score in 27613, Raleigh, North Carolina is 68 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

68.61 percent of residents in 27613 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 9.26 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Rex Hospital with a distance of 7.64 miles from the area.

**Drive Times and Roadways: The Backbone of Access**

For many residents of 27613, personal vehicles are the primary mode of transportation. Several major roadways facilitate access to healthcare facilities. Driving to the WakeMed North Hospital, a major healthcare provider, typically involves navigating major thoroughfares. From central 27613, a drive east on Strickland Road merges onto US-1 North. Depending on traffic, the journey can take 15-25 minutes. Alternatively, traveling south on Creedmoor Road offers another route, though traffic congestion during peak hours can significantly extend travel times.

The drive to Duke Raleigh Hospital, located south of 27613, involves heading south on Creedmoor Road, and then onto I-440. The journey is usually around 20-30 minutes, depending on traffic on I-440, which can be heavy during rush hour. The ability to choose between multiple routes, including surface streets and the interstate, offers flexibility and can mitigate the impact of unexpected delays.

Access to smaller clinics and specialist offices within 27613 and surrounding areas often involves navigating local roads like Lynn Road, Six Forks Road, and Falls of Neuse Road. These routes offer more direct access, but can be subject to traffic lights and slower speeds. The overall drive-time score is generally favorable, reflecting the proximity to major hospitals and healthcare providers. However, traffic, particularly during peak hours, should be factored into any healthcare planning.

**Public Transit: Navigating the Network**

The public transit system in Raleigh, GoRaleigh, offers a viable alternative for some residents, particularly those seeking to avoid traffic or who do not have access to a personal vehicle. Several bus routes serve the 27613 area, providing connections to major healthcare facilities. Route 22, for example, travels along Falls of Neuse Road, offering access to various medical offices and connecting to transfer points for other routes. Route 2, another key route, runs along Creedmoor Road, providing access to WakeMed North Hospital and other medical facilities.

GoRaleigh prioritizes accessibility, with all buses equipped with wheelchair lifts and other features to accommodate passengers with disabilities. The system also offers GoRaleigh Access, a paratransit service for individuals who cannot use the regular bus service due to a disability. However, public transit in Raleigh can be limited in frequency, especially during off-peak hours and weekends. Travel times are also generally longer compared to driving. For individuals requiring frequent appointments or experiencing acute symptoms, public transit may not be the most practical or efficient option.

**Ride-Sharing and Medical Transport: Bridging the Gaps**

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ft provide on-demand transportation, offering a convenient alternative to driving or public transit. These services are readily available in 27613, providing access to healthcare facilities at any time of day. Ride-sharing is particularly useful for individuals who cannot drive, are unable to use public transit, or need a quick and reliable way to get to appointments. The cost, however, can be a factor, especially for frequent trips.

Medical transport services, such as those offered by companies like Firstat Nursing Services, provide specialized transportation for individuals with medical needs. These services often include assistance with mobility, stretcher transportation, and medical equipment. They are particularly valuable for individuals who require specialized care or assistance during transport. However, medical transport services can be more expensive than ride-sharing or public transit.
